Can gallstones cause stomach pain?

Gallstones can indeed cause stomach pain. Although gallstones primarily affect the gallbladder, due to their anatomical location, they can cause discomfort in the upper left abdomen that can sometimes be mistaken for stomach pain. It is important to see a doctor promptly if the pain is severe or is accompanied by other symptoms.

Gallstones are a common digestive system disease caused by the deposition of certain components in bile to form crystalline substances. The causes of gallstone formation are relatively complex, mainly involving changes in bile components, such as high cholesterol levels, insufficient bile acid, bile salt concentration, etc. These changes may be related to a variety of factors such as diet, genetics, weight, gender and age.

The pain caused by gallstones usually occurs in the right upper abdomen and is called biliary colic. This pain is often intermittent and ranges from mild discomfort to severe pain. It is sometimes accompanied by nausea, vomiting, and radiating pain in the back. Although the symptoms of gallstones can sometimes resemble stomach discomfort, the characteristics and location of the pain are usually different from typical stomach pain. Symptoms that worsen after eating greasy foods are also a sign of gallstones.

Maintaining a healthy lifestyle is essential for gallstone management, and working on your eating habits can help reduce symptoms. It is recommended to avoid excessive intake of animal fats and increase the intake of dietary fiber, such as fresh fruits and vegetables. Regular exercise and maintaining a reasonable weight are also effective preventive measures. If you experience recurring severe pain or other suspected gallstone symptoms, you should consult a professional medical professional as soon as possible for further diagnosis and treatment advice.
